Edit: I just read your other post, sounds like you are going through a really tough time right now. And having some problems finding a doctor. The two of the three best treatments you dont even need a doctor.

You need to do 3 things:
1. VED Therapy (I recommend the Augusta medical vacuum, but a cheap one for Amazon will get you by).
2. Stretching therapy (I recommend the X4 stretcher. I've tried one other one and I like this one the best so far).
3. Oral meds including: Pentoxifyline 1200mg/day ,, L-Arginine 1000mg/day, Citrulline 1000mg/day

The only thing you need a doc for is the pentox. and its easy to get. good luck.

Post by: Dared on December 17, 2015, 11:58:22 PM
It can help with loss of girth and length. I have a more severe case and so I've still lost girth even with stretching. The key to stretching/traction is to do it consistently. Also, I would highly recommend pentox and acetyl l carnitine. Both have helped me tremendously when combined with traction. Get the phallosan forte if you go the traction route. Some people seem to have success with the ved but unfortunately i further injured myself with the ved despite the fact i followed the protocol posted on here to the t. good luck.
